FCC Chair Rejects Trump Call to Pull ABC Licenses Over Presidential Debate

Adweek.com 

Jessica Rosenworcel, chair of the Federal Communications Commission, rejected former President Donald Trump's suggestion that Disney-owned ABC should lose its broadcast licenses over the network's moderating of the Sept. 10 presidential debate. NZ' Glenn Phillips completes 3,000 international cricket runs

BigNewsNetwork.com (sports) 

Galle [Sri Lanka], September 20 (ANI): New Zealand all-rounder Glenn Phillips completed 3,000 runs in international cricket. Phillips accomplished this milestone during the first Test against Sri Lanka at Galle. In the match, during the first inning, Phillips played a fine cameo of 49 in just 48 balls, with two fours and five big sixes. His runs came at a strike rate of over 102. Domestic steel sector to outpace real GDP growth, boosted by urbanisation and capex: Anand Rathi report

BigNewsNetwork.com 

New Delhi [India], September 20 (ANI): The domestic steel sector growth will outpace the country's real GDP growth in the coming years, says a report by Anand Rathi. The growth in domestic steel will be driven by rapid urbanisation and an increase in public-private capital expenditure (capex). PCB shifts Pakistan's second Test against England to Multan amidst ongoing "major facelift" in Karachi stadium

BigNewsNetwork.com (sports) 

Islamabad [Pakistan], September 20 (ANI): The second Test between Pakistan and England has been shifted from Karachi to Multan due to the ongoing renovation work at the stadium for the next year's ICC Champions Trophy in Pakistan. Kumar Tuhin appointed as next Ambassador of India to Netherlands: MEA

BrazilNews.net 

New Delhi [India], September 20 (ANI): Kumar Tuhin has been appointed as the next Ambassador of India to the Kingdom of the Netherlands, a statement by the Ministry of External Affairs said on Friday. The 1991 batch Indian Foreign Service officer is presently Director General at Indian Council for Cultural Relations, the statement said. He is expected to take up the assignment shortly. 40 years after astronaut Rakesh Sharma, Shubhanshu Shukla is the first Indian to travel to space: Here's how is gearing up for ISS

Economictimes.indiatimes.com 

Group Captain Shubhanshu Shukla of the Indian Air Force will pilot the Axiom-4 mission to the International Space Station in 2025. This marks India's first human presence aboard the ISS and its second government-sponsored human spaceflight since 1984. The mission is a collaboration between India and the United States.
